REMOTE CONTROL F. PRACTIX SYSTEMS by Philips

Product Overview
Key highlights
The Philips Remote Control for Practix Systems enhances operational efficiency in radiology environments. Designed for compatibility with the Practix 300, Practix Convenio, and Practix 400 models, it streamlines workflow and improves user experience, making it an essential tool for medical imaging professionals. Technical Specifications
| Parameter | Value |
|---|---|
| Brand | Philips |
| Part Number | 451210467323 |
| Compatibility | PRACTIX 300, PRACTIX CONVENIO, PRACTIX 400 |
